HR 6266 · 93th Congress · Government Operations and Politics

A bill designating the first Tuesday of November in even-numbered years as "National Election Day".

Introduced 1973-03-28· Sponsored by Rep. Podell, Bertram L. [D-NY-13]· House

Latest: Referred to House Committee on Judiciary.(1973-03-28)

Plain Language Summary

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Designates the first Tuesday of November in even-numbered years as a national holiday for the purpose of conducting Federal elections.…
